Determining Job Waste Volume


Precise estimation of job waste volume is important in picking the appropriate dumpster size, as insufficient capability can result in pricey overflows and unscheduled pickups. Failing to precisely approximate waste volume can result in job hold-ups, increased costs, and an unfavorable impact on the environment.


To prevent these concerns, it'' s important to consider the task timeline and the kinds of materials that will be created throughout the task.


Estimating waste volume includes determining the quantity of waste that will be generated during each phase of the job. This can be attained by breaking down the project into smaller jobs, recognizing the products that will be utilized, and estimating the waste produced by each task.


For instance, a building and construction project might produce waste from demolition, excavation, and construction products. By approximating the waste volume for each task, job managers can identify the overall waste volume and choose the suitable dumpster size. By doing so, they can ensure a smooth project timeline, lower costs, and decrease the ecological impact of the project.

Complying With Weight Capability Limits


Dumpster weight capability limitations are substantial considerations, as exceeding these limitations can result in safety risks, extra charges, and even dumpster rejection by the rental company. Comprehending the weight capability of your rented dumpster is necessary to prevent overloading, which can cause damage to the dumpster, surrounding property, and even injury to people close by. Proper weight circulation is essential to preventing overloading, so it'' s important to distribute the weight of the debris equally throughout the dumpster.


This can be achieved by positioning heavier products at the bottom and stabilizing them with lighter materials. Furthermore, it'' s necessary to keep an eye on the weight of the debris as it accumulates and stop including materials when the capability is reached. Exceeding the weight limitation can lead to additional costs, and sometimes, the rental business may refuse to collect the dumpster.

Can I Put a Dumpster on the Street or Pathway?


When choosing where to put a dumpster, it'' s crucial to take into account regional guidelines. Usually, you'' ll need street permits to place a dumpster on the street, while pathway regulations may forbid or restrict dumpster placement.


Contact your city government to determine specific requirements, as lawbreakers may face fines or elimination of the dumpster. Keep compliance to avoid disturbances to your job and possible legal problems.
